摘要
Since pre-filter is more likely to cause the orthogonality and symmetry 'losses' of multi wavelet, and to cause the increase of the compact support of the base function, a multiwavelet 'balanced' algorithm is proposed to make multiwavelets have the same properties with single wavelets. Taking full advantages of the structures of balanced multiwavelet decomposition coefficients, the Embedded Block Coding with Optimal Truncation (EBCOT) image coding algorithm is used to compress the coefficients of balanced multiwavelet. When the compressed ratio reaches 32, the PSNR is 31.3427. The experimental results show that the balanced multiwavelet algorithm based on EBCOT has many good characteristics, such as orthogonality, short support, high vanishing moments, etc., which is a more effective method for aviation image compression.
